A study of university students in Bangladesh found associations between specific caffeine use disorder symptoms and sleep problems. The study found that caffeine use disorder symptoms had both a direct effect on sleep problems and an indirect effect on sleep problems through depressive symptoms. The paper was published in Addictive Behaviors Reports.
Caffeine is one of the most widely consumed psychoactive substances. It is commonly used to increase alertness and reduce fatigue. Among university students, caffeine consumption is especially common because of demanding academic schedules, long study hours, and insufficient sleep. Although moderate caffeine use may temporarily improve wakefulness and concentration, excessive or poorly timed consumption can interfere with sleep quality.
Sleep disturbances are themselves associated with impaired daily functioning, poorer mood, and an increased risk of depressive symptoms. Caffeine use and mental health may therefore be connected through several interacting behavioral and psychological pathways. An important factor in understanding these relationships is why individuals consume caffeine, as motives may include increasing alertness, regulating mood, socializing, controlling weight, or relieving withdrawal symptoms.
Some individuals also develop problematic patterns of caffeine use. These patterns are characterized by difficulty reducing consumption despite experiencing negative consequences. Symptoms of caffeine use disorder may be associated with greater psychological distress, anxiety, and sleep problems.
Study author Shekh Tanjina Islam Dola and her colleagues investigated the relationship between caffeine use motives, caffeine use disorder symptoms, depression and sleep problems among university students. In their study, they used statistical techniques that allowed them to map associations between specific symptoms of each of these conditions and to test the direct and indirect pathways between them.
The study participants were 530 students from the Barishal division of Bangladesh. They came from two public universities – Patuakhali Science and Technology University and University of Barisal. Participants’ average age was 22 years. 57% were male. 72% reported caffeine consumption. On average, caffeine consumers reported ingesting 1.9 cups of caffeine drinks (tea/coffee) per day.
Participants completed a survey that contained sociodemographic questions and assessments of caffeine consumption motives (the Caffeine Motives Questionnaire-21), caffeine use disorder symptoms (the Caffeine Use Disorder Questionnaire-10), sleep quality (the Medical Outcomes Study Sleep Scale), and depressive symptoms (the Patient Health Questionnaire-9).
The results showed that caffeine intake was higher among smokers compared to non-smokers. It was also higher among those with loans or debts, those in certain academic years, and those with lower monthly family expenditures. It was not associated with age, gender, residency, income, and several other factors.
More severe caffeine use disorder symptoms were directly associated with more sleep problems and more severe depressive symptoms. Depressive symptoms were, in turn, associated with more sleep problems, meaning depression partially mediated the relationship between caffeine use disorder and sleep disturbances. The researchers also found that craving and withdrawal-related motives were key bridges connecting caffeine use disorder to these negative mental health and sleep outcomes.
“This study found a high prevalence of caffeine consumption among university students in Bangladesh and identified important psychological correlates, particularly depression and sleep problems. Network analysis suggests that certain features, especially craving and withdrawal-related symptoms, may play a key role in connecting caffeine use disorder with mental health and sleep-related outcomes,” the study authors concluded.
The study contributes to the scientific understanding of the links between caffeine consumption and mental health. However, it should be noted that study participants were exclusively university students, making generalizability of the findings to other demographic groups limited. Additionally, the cross-sectional design of the study does not allow any causal inferences to be derived from the results.
